2. Types of Compressors: There are several types of AC compressors, including reciprocating, scroll, rotary, and variable speed compressors. Reciprocating compressors use pistons to compress the refrigerant gas, while scroll compressors use spiral-shaped scrolls to create compression. Rotary compressors use rotary motion to compress the gas, and variable speed compressors can adjust their speed based on cooling needs, providing more energy efficiency.

Function of the Mass Airflow Sensor:
The MAF sensor is responsible for measuring the amount of air entering the engine. This information is vital for the engine control unit (ECU) to accurately calculate the amount of fuel needed for combustion. By maintaining the ideal air-fuel ratio, the MAF sensor helps optimize engine performance, fuel efficiency, and emissions levels.
It is important to regularly replace or clean air filters to maintain their effectiveness. A clogged or dirty air filter can restrict airflow, reduce the efficiency of the HVAC system, and lead to increased energy consumption. Most manufacturers recommend changing the filter every 30-90 days, depending on factors such as the type of filter, indoor air quality, and frequency of use.

Proper maintenance and care of the oil pump are essential to ensure the engine's longevity and performance. Regular oil changes with high-quality oil and filters help keep the pump lubricated and free of debris that may hinder its operation. It is also crucial to monitor the oil pressure gauge on the dashboard to ensure that the pump is functioning correctly.
